The compulsory documents required for the Caste Certificate are- Identity Proof [Aadhaar card, passport, Voter ID, Driving License, PAN Card, MNREGA Card], Address Proof [ration card, electricity Bill, Aadhaar card, water bill, voter ID], and affidavit for caste certificate.
The important information required by the Department such as the name of the applicant, Sex M/F, Father’s/Husband’s Name, residential address, ration card number, details of community certificate of parents, and date of the application.
Caste Certificate is needed if you belong to the SC/ST caste and want to take the benefits of reservation in the case of admission to school/college, scholarships, housing and self-employment schemes, allotment or assignment of land, a candidate in the election.
A caste certificate is issued by the authorized authority of state government. There is some prescribed authority who are able to issue the caste certificate. These authorities are-The District Magistrate/The Additional District Magistrate, Collector/Deputy Collector, Deputy Commissioner/Additional Deputy Commissioner, Sub Divisional Magistrate, Extra Assistant Magistrate, Executive Magistrate, and Taluka Magistrate. The Revenue-officer and the sub-divisional officer of the area also issued the Caste Certificate. The certificate issued by these authorities are accepted by the State Government.
For caste certificate, you can apply online by this process-visit the web portal BACKWARD CLASS WELFARE PORTAL of our state. Then click on APPLY FOR CASTE CERTIFICATE ONLINE. There is an option for a new account or directly fill the form. You have to LOG INTO your account. Then fill the details in online form like Personal details, Address details, Contact details, details of local reference and father’s or any blood relative caste certificate details. Verified your details and click on the SUBMIT button. For uploading choose the type document. Click on the SUBMIT button after uploading of the scanned copy. then you get application number on acknowledgment slip after application loaded successfully. You get MSG or MAIL after one the process is done. You can download your certificate from your account after the successful verification online.
To apply offline visit Tehsil Office, Revenue Office, or SDM office. Get an application form the office and fill all the details in the form. You have to fill Personel, Address, or contacts details in the form. In the form, you have to fill the details of caste certificate of your father or any blood relative. Then tick the option of Caste. Fill and sign the form. You may ask for the 2 passports sized photograph. This process can take approximately one month. You get your certificate from the office.
